For all you racing game enthusiasts out there, don’t miss the latest exciting update on Sonic Racing: CrossWorlds! Ahmed Hassan delved into the recent State of Play reveal where Sega announced new DLC featuring iconic characters Mega Man and Proto Man. The post, published on September 29, also includes a gameplay video showcasing Rush as a drivable vehicle and more character additions in the pipeline. If you’re a fan of the age-old marketing battle between Battlefield and Call of Duty, be sure to check out “Battlefield 6 Openly Mocks Call of Duty, and it’s Amusing” by Jonathan Dubinski (September 29, 2025). In this piece, Jonathan dives into DICE’s latest trailer for Battlefield 6, which cleverly pokes fun at Activision’s celebrity-laden marketing tactics. With cameos from Zac Efron and others swiftly dispatched by a missile, the studio makes a bold statement about what truly matters in their game. As both titles prepare to hit shelves this October, Jonathan’s article offers an entertaining take on how Battlefield is setting itself apart in the realm of military shooters.
